Bathtub Material Comparison: Making the Right Choice

Selecting the right material is crucial for durability, maintenance, and style. Each option offers unique benefits and drawbacks, so understanding these can help you make an informed decision that aligns with your renovation goals.
Choosing the right bathtub material is a balance of practicality, budget, and personal style—never underestimate the power of a well-chosen centerpiece.
MaterialProsCons
AcrylicLightweight, affordable, easy to installProne to scratching, may discolor over time
Cast IronExtremely durable, excellent heat retentionVery heavy, requires reinforced flooring
Stone ResinLuxurious appearance, retains heat wellExpensive, heavy
FiberglassBudget-friendly, easy to repairLess durable, can flex and crack
Steel EnamelScratch-resistant, sleek finishCold to touch, can chip

Modern Bathtub Installation Methods: Retrofit vs. Full Replacement

Depending on your renovation scope and budget, you may opt for a simple retrofit or a complete replacement. Each method has distinct implications for project duration, cost, and potential disruption to daily life.
  • Retrofit Installation: Placing a new tub liner over the existing tub, ideal for quick updates but may reduce bathing space.
  • Full Replacement: Removing the old tub entirely, allowing for layout changes and modern plumbing upgrades.

Cost Considerations: Budgeting for Bathtub Replacement

Understanding the financial aspects of bathtub replacement is essential for a successful renovation. Costs can vary significantly based on material, installation complexity, and additional features.
FactorEstimated Cost Range
Bathtub (basic to luxury)$300 – $5,000+
Installation labor$500 – $2,000
Plumbing upgrades$200 – $1,500
Disposal of old tub$100 – $300

Expert Tips for a Seamless Bathtub Upgrade

A well-executed bathtub replacement requires careful planning and attention to detail. From measuring access points to ensuring waterproofing integrity, these strategies can help you avoid common pitfalls.
  • Measure doorways and hallways before purchasing a new tub.
  • Consult with a licensed plumber for complex installations.
  • Prioritize non-slip finishes for added safety.
  • Coordinate tub style with overall bathroom aesthetics.
